About this audiobook
This exploration of plant behavior and adaptation shows how we might improve human society by better appreciating and understanding plants and how they function.
Author
Beronda L. Montgomery
Beronda L. Montgomery is MSU Foundation Professor of Biochemistry & Molecular Biology and Microbiology & Molecular Genetics at Michigan State University. A fellow of the American Association for the Advancement of Science and the American Academy of Microbiology, she was named one of Cell’s 100 Inspiring Black Scientists in America.
